Is 107 a deficient number?




Here we will explain and calculate if 107 is a deficient number and its deficiency if applicable.

107 is a deficient number if the sum of its proper divisors is less than 107.

The sum of its proper divisors is calculated as follows: 1 = 1.

1 is less than 107. Therefore, 107 is a deficient number.

The deficiency of 107 is 107 minus the sum of its proper divisors. Thus, the deficiency of 107 is 107 - 1 = 106
